Output ec3f276cb28702c926ddb0b755316c5fe1b833e7b96cb72171fbbc12e05255e9:3
- value
- 958570000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7854a101caeb886a00266f086496d981c688474 OP_EQUAL
- address
- 3QFnW2f431WnG8GiZBGM3RV7gtCQUbcf5j
- transaction
- ec3f276cb28702c926ddb0b755316c5fe1b833e7b96cb72171fbbc12e05255e9